Studying Online at Ogeechee Technical College
Distance learning is available at Ogeechee Technical College. Of 2,300 students, 582 (25%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 812 (35%) took at least some classes online.

Early Childhood Education Associate’s Program at Ogeechee Technical College
Among the 7 associate’s early childhood education graduates at Ogeechee Technical College, 100% were women (7) and 0% were men (0).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Early Childhood Education associate’s degree recipients at Ogeechee Technical College.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 5 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 1 |
| Black / African American | 1 |
Minority students account for 29% of Early Childhood Education associate’s degree recipients at Ogeechee Technical College, lower than the national average of 52%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
